From December 12th-19th, Father Stephen will be representing the Salisbury Diocese and the Anglican Communion in Romania taking a fraternal message from the Bishop David to Church leaders in different denominations who are marking 20 years of the fall of the Iron Curtain. A fuller report in the parish magazine.

Our expenditure amounts to approximately £1,400 per week. This includes £911.86 per week which goes to the Diocese for our ‘Share’ Last weeks donations were as follows: Planned Giving £2,186.75 (including standing orders) Collections £229.00. Our income tax claim produces the equivalent of an additional £170 approx. per week. The shortfall is made up from fund raising.

If you pay Income Tax, in each chair can be found a yellow giving envelope. Loose collection can be placed in these envelopes, completing the details requested (this will enable us to reclaim 28p in the £ from the Inland Revenue). If you are a non-tax payer, please put your loose collection straight into the collecting bag when this is passed round during the service. Through our Planned Giving Scheme, church members commit a regular amount of money in order that we may be able to rely on a predictable income to meet our needs and responsibilities.
